The Influence of Temperature on Paint Application
When you're preparing a commercial outside paint job, the temperature level can substantially affect how well the paint sticks and dries out.
Ideally, you want to paint when temperature levels vary between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's as well cool, the paint may not cure correctly, causing problems like peeling or splitting.
On the other side, if it's as well warm, the paint can dry too swiftly, stopping proper attachment and resulting in an unequal surface.
You ought to also think about the time of day; morning or late afternoon offers cooler temperatures, which can be much more positive.
Constantly inspect the manufacturer's recommendations for the details paint you're utilizing, as they usually provide assistance on the suitable temperature level array for optimum outcomes.
Moisture and Its Effect on Drying Times
Temperature level isn't the only ecological aspect that influences your business outside painting task; humidity plays a significant function too. High moisture degrees can decrease drying times drastically, affecting the general high quality of your paint work.
When the air is saturated with moisture, the paint takes longer to treat, which can result in issues like poor adhesion and a higher risk of mildew development. If you're painting on a specifically damp day, be prepared for prolonged wait times in between layers.

Best Seasons for Commercial Exterior Paint Projects
What's the most effective time of year for your business external paint tasks?
Spring and very early loss are generally your best choices. Throughout these seasons, temperatures are mild, and moisture degrees are frequently reduced, creating optimal problems for paint application and drying.
